What Are Perfumed Wax Melts?

Perfumed wax melts are small, highly scented pieces of wax that release fragrance when melted. They are designed to be used in a wax melt warmer, which gently heats the wax to release its aroma. Unlike traditional candles, wax melts don’t have a wick and don't require a flame. Instead, they use a heat source, such as a light bulb or electric warmer, to melt the wax and release the fragrance into the air.

Perfumed wax melts are available in a wide variety of fragrances, from floral and fruity to spicy and earthy. They’re an excellent option for those who want to change up their home’s scent regularly or for people who find lighting candles inconvenient or unsafe. Wax melts are also an eco-friendly alternative since they typically use natural waxes like soy, beeswax, or coconut wax.

Benefits of Using Perfumed Wax Melts

1. Convenient and Mess-Free

One of the main advantages of perfumed wax melts is their convenience. You don’t have to worry about trimming a wick or dealing with wax spills. Simply place the wax melt in your warmer, turn it on, and enjoy the fragrance. When you’re done, you can easily switch out the wax without the mess that can come with traditional candles.

2. Longer-Lasting Fragrance

Perfumed wax melts are known to last longer than traditional candles. While the exact duration will depend on the type of wax and scent, many users report that wax melts can last anywhere from 8 to 12 hours per use, providing an extended fragrance experience compared to burning a candle.

3. Safer Than Candles

Since perfumed wax melts don’t require an open flame, they’re a safer option for homes with children or pets. The heat source is contained within the warmer, making them a much safer alternative to candles. This makes wax melts a great choice for families or anyone looking for a safer way to enjoy fragrances in their home.

4. Variety of Scents

With perfumed wax melts, the scent options are endless. From calming lavender to refreshing citrus or warm vanilla, there’s a fragrance to suit every mood and season. Whether you prefer something floral, fresh, or cozy, you can easily switch out different wax melts to create a new ambiance in your home.

How to Use Perfumed Wax Melts

1. Choose a Wax Melt Warmer

To use perfumed wax melts, you’ll need a wax melt warmer. These come in two types: electric and tea light-based. Electric warmers heat the wax using electricity, while tea light warmers use a small candle to melt the wax. Electric warmers are often more convenient, as they allow you to control the temperature more precisely, while tea light warmers provide a more traditional, cozy experience.

2. Place the Wax Melt in the Warmer

Once you have your warmer, simply place a cube or two of your perfumed wax melt into the dish. Make sure not to overfill, as the wax will melt and could spill over the sides.

3. Turn on the Warmer

After placing the wax melt in the warmer, turn it on and allow the wax to melt slowly. The heat will release the fragrance into the air, filling your space with a lovely scent. Be sure to monitor the wax and turn off the warmer when you’re done to prevent overheating.

4. Switch Out the Wax

Once the scent has faded, you can easily switch out the wax. Let the wax cool, and then remove it from the warmer. Some warmers allow the wax to harden and easily pop out, while others may require you to wipe the dish clean before adding new wax melts.

Popular Scents for Perfumed Wax Melts

1. Lavender

Known for its calming and relaxing properties, lavender is a popular choice for creating a peaceful atmosphere. It’s perfect for the bedroom or bathroom, helping to reduce stress and promote better sleep.

2. Vanilla

Vanilla is a warm, comforting scent that adds a cozy, inviting touch to any room. It’s great for the living room or kitchen and pairs well with other sweet or spicy fragrances like cinnamon or caramel.

3. Citrus

Citrus scents like lemon, orange, and grapefruit are refreshing and energizing. These are ideal for kitchens or bathrooms and work well during the day to keep your space feeling fresh and lively.

4. Eucalyptus and Mint

If you're looking for something invigorating and refreshing, eucalyptus and mint are perfect. These scents are great for clearing your mind, helping with focus, or creating a spa-like atmosphere at home.
